The Networks
The Networks Platform, developed by the Centre for Sustainable Healthcare, provides a digital space for sharing resources, knowledge, and ideas, and connecting with like-minded individuals from around the world.

The Networks community is an internationally respected online platform, for all those interested in making healthcare sustainable. Our community is open to everyone, including healthcare professionals, patients, administrators, researchers, students, and more. By joining our networks, you will have access to a wealth of resources and opportunities to connect with others working or interested in the field, including:
- A resource library of academic publications, case studies, education and training resources, policy reports, and more
- Access to over 30 growing specialty networks with a membershipof almost 10,000 individuals and organisations working towards sustainability in healthcare
- Access to a safe and friendly platform for sharing your own resources, ideas, questions and answers with others in the community
- Opportunities to like and comment on others’ posts, take part in discussions, stay up to date with events and more
Our mission
1. To cultivate and support an international community to enable learning, sharing, and collaboration on sustainability in healthcare.
2. To build a shared identity for those interested in creating more sustainable healthcare practices.
3. To create a practical space to share good practice, ask questions, hold resources, advertise events and signpost (to both CSH and external events, resources & support).
Network Co-leads
Our network co-leads are volunteers who kindly support the Networks, from regular posting and uploading the latest research and case study information, to setting up and hosting network events. Each network has multiple co-leads, there is no limit to the number of co-leads in each network.
